This week’s theme was Devotion to Our Lady and our Enterprise capabilities were Research and Analysis. We have returned form our Easter break to focus on an intense term of examination preparation and course completion.
Our Polish Complementary School will recommence this week – around thirty learners from all year groups meet for two hours after school each week in our Partnership Learning Centre – see Miss Taylor for details.
The Musicals Group have been rehearsing for their performance at The Gracie Fields Theatre on Thursday – congratulations to all involved for reaching this celebratory stage.
The facilities in our Partnership Learning Centre are available for parents and for any Parish Groups who wish to produce resources for church or develop their own learning. We now have a group of parents following a computing course in school. If you would like to be a part of this, please speak to Louise Moore for details (01706 647761).
